Choosing the right traffic source
Affiliate marketing allows brands to collaborate with affiliates—ranging from bloggers to influencers to large-scale content creators—who promote the company’s products or services. In return, affiliates earn a commission for each sale or lead they generate. This performance-based model is appealing to both businesses and marketers because it minimizes upfront costs while maximizing potential returns.
A significant advantage of affiliate marketing is the wide variety of traffic sources affiliates use to drive engagement. These channels not only diversify the ways in which your products or services are marketed but also offer an opportunity to reach audiences in different formats. Let’s take a look at some of the key traffic sources used in affiliate marketing:
- Social Media: Platforms like Facebook, Instagram, TikTok, and YouTube have become goldmines for affiliate marketers. These platforms allow affiliates to create engaging content that directly speaks to their followers, using features like sponsored posts, stories, and affiliate links.
- Native Advertising: Native ads blend seamlessly with the content of a website, providing a non-intrusive way to introduce affiliate offers. This form of advertising doesn’t disrupt the user experience, making it more likely for the audience to click through and convert.
- Push Notifications: Push notification ads are short, direct messages sent to users’ devices to grab attention instantly. Used strategically, push notifications can help affiliates drive traffic to sales pages, product offers, or special promotions.
- Pop-up and Pop-under Ads: While these forms of ads can be intrusive, they have been proven to generate high engagement. Pop-ups appear directly in front of the user, while pop-unders open in a new window behind the active browser.
- Email Marketing: Email remains one of the most effective ways to nurture relationships with potential customers. Whether through newsletters, promotional emails, or exclusive offers, email marketing enables affiliates to reach out directly to interested subscribers and drive conversions.
Content Creation: Crafting High-Impact Landing Pages and Creatives
In affiliate marketing, compelling content plays a pivotal role in converting traffic into sales. Whether you’re promoting physical products or digital services, the quality of your landing pages, creatives, and overall content can make or break your affiliate campaigns in 2025.
Here’s how to effectively create content that drives conversions:
Landing Pages That Convert
A well-designed landing page is essential for any affiliate marketer. It’s the page where all your traffic lands, and it should be optimized to convert visitors into customers. Here are some best practices for creating high-converting landing pages:
- Clear and Compelling Headline: The headline is the first thing visitors will see, and it should immediately communicate the value of what you’re promoting. Be concise and compelling to grab attention.
- Engaging Visuals: Use high-quality images or videos of the product you’re promoting. Visuals help build trust and give your audience a clearer understanding of what they’re purchasing. Additionally, explainer videos or product demos can boost conversions.
- Strong Call-to-Action (CTA): Your CTA should stand out and tell the visitor exactly what to do next. Whether it’s “Buy Now,” “Learn More,” or “Get Started,” your CTA should be action-oriented and easy to spot.
- Social Proof and Testimonials: Adding testimonials, customer reviews, or case studies to your landing page can help build trust and reduce skepticism. People are more likely to buy when they see others have had positive experiences.
- Mobile Optimization: With mobile traffic continuing to grow, ensure your landing pages are responsive and look great on all devices. Slow or poorly optimized pages can lead to high bounce rates.
High-Quality Creatives
Whether you’re creating ads for social media,native, pop-up/under ads, or email campaigns, the creatives you use can significantly impact your performance. Here are some tips for creating high-quality visuals:
- Design with Purpose: Each creative piece should have a clear purpose, whether it’s to inform, persuade, or entertain. Keep your designs simple, eye-catching, and relevant to the product you’re promoting.
- A/B Testing Creatives: Just like landing pages, creatives benefit from continuous testing. A/B testing different designs, headlines, and calls to action helps determine what resonates most with your audience. This will allow you to fine-tune your approach and optimize for the best results.
- Adapt for Platform: Different platforms have different requirements for creative sizes and styles. A successful Instagram story ad may not work as well as a YouTube thumbnail, so tailor your creatives for the platform you’re using.
SEO and Content Strategy
To maximize the effectiveness of your content, incorporate Search Engine Optimization (SEO) strategies. High-quality content that ranks well on Google can attract organic traffic to your affiliate links. Here’s how you can improve your content’s SEO:
- Keyword Research: Focus on long-tail keywords that are relevant to your affiliate product. This will help your content rank in search engines and attract more targeted traffic.
- Content Clusters: Create content clusters around a central topic. For example, if you’re promoting a fitness product, you could create blog posts about health, workouts, nutrition, and related affiliate products, all linking back to the main product page. This helps with SEO and establishes authority in your niche.
- Link Building: Incorporating internal and external links into your content can improve your website’s SEO and increase the chances of ranking higher in search engine results.

Data-Driven Decisions: Tracking Performance
Affiliate marketing is all about optimizing your efforts. In 2025, using data and analytics to track your affiliate links’ performance is more important than ever. Real-time tracking helps marketers identify which products and strategies are working, and which need improvement.
Tip: Set up conversion tracking on your Ads, A/B test different offers, and use heatmaps to understand user behavior. The more data you gather, the better you can fine-tune your campaigns for maximum ROI.
Building Trust and Credibility
The success of affiliate marketing hinges on building strong, trustworthy relationships between businesses and affiliates. When managed effectively, affiliate marketing programs offer benefits such as:
Extended Reach: By partnering with affiliates who have access to large, diverse audiences, brands can expand their visibility across new markets and demographics.
Cost-Effective Advertising: Since affiliate marketers are only paid based on performance (such as a sale or lead), companies minimize the risk of paying for ineffective advertising.
Credibility & Trust: Affiliates, especially influencers and content creators, often have established trust with their audience. When they recommend a product, their followers are more likely to view it as a genuine endorsement.
Scalability: Affiliate marketing programs can easily be scaled as your brand grows. You can add new affiliates, experiment with various commissions, and adjust strategies to meet evolving goals.
